Mary's Taqueria is a cozy corner spot dishing out delicious, authentic Mexican tacos and entrees, complete with a mini grocery section for any cravings.

"Mary's Taqueria (1901 St. Canalport Ave.) is an under-the-radar taco spot/corner store that has some of the best tacos in the city. Also don't sleep on their creamy green salsa." - Tim Flores and Genie Kwon

Anyways, we were in the area doing some shopping when we decide to hang around the area to grab Mexican food for lunch. A quick Yelp review and boom something cheap and nearby... Mary's Taqueria! Definitely a hole in the wall sort of spot. Kinda looks like someone's house converted into part mini convenience store and part taqueria. No problem finding free street parking nearby. Huge sign from the front and being located on the corner of the intersection makes this an easy spot to find. Once in, you make your way to the back to order to go if you like or you can take a seat and a waitress will bring you menus. I ended up ordering a carne asada burrito, an al pastor taco, and a large horchata. Initially, when the food came out it definitely looked legit. But taste-wise, I've definitely had better. First ate the al pastor taco, which I found to be overly greasy. Next moved onto the asada burrito. While it does look big in size, it's mostly filled with lettuce which gives it it's deceiving size. The carne asada itself was kind meh, and definitely over board on the cheese & sour cream. Horchata was solid and I also did enjoy their green and red salsa which were in these easy squeeze bottles. No issues dousing eat bite with more and more salsa. Bring cash if you want to avoid the $1 fee on credit and debit charges. This is on of those spots where I can't complain the food is horrible but definitely not a spot I'd bother to come back for. 'Til next time! 85/365

We stopped by on a Friday night to check out Mary's. I wanted to see how things were since the last time I visited. The place has revamped the menu (also the prices) and the entire establishment. It looks more like a restaurant and less like a convenience store. They enlarged the kitchen area, the seating area, and reduced the size of the convenience store area. Its a lot brighter and I love the new construction of the floors and space. Sadly, with any restaurant remodel comes an increase with prices. The 3 taco dinner with rice and beans is now $8.99. The guacamole is now $5.49 and the cost per taco is about $2.09. We dined in and service was great and so was the ambiance. It was really comfortable for us eating there. The quality of the food was also very good. I'd say I'd definitely come back!

Mary's Taqueria is The Best!!!!!! Tops Amazing Delicious Mexican Cuisine tucked away in the back of a Mom and niece's run tiny corner grocery store. Scrumptious inexpensive food! Mary Arriaga lives in Mexico, and her daughter Maria Flores brings mom's recipes to life here in Pilsen....Chef Alberto runs the kitchen and creates mini masterpieces of everyday Mexican dishes. I love the Chicken Tacos in flour tortillas..I ask for cilantro onions of course, and add cheese sour cream, lettuce and tomatoes ...my artist girlfriend and Pilsen native Pamela loves the Chili Rellenos tacos. The Guacamole and chips reign supreme...and you must order a side of the creamy avocado sauce...which I use on everything...yummy tangy sauce found nowhere else in the city. Niece Emily or her sister are wonderful servers and are kind and quick to help any newcomer decide what to order, and the food comes out fast and hot. The tiny dining area has maybe four booths and two tables...so quaint and out of the way.....you won't see any lines out the door, unless maybe at lunch time. The prices are as amazing as the food. Love me some Marys Taqueria!
